City of Vancouver issues 12th marijuana-related business licence to Cambie Street dispensary
Amid grumblings toward Ontario's pot plan and federal discussions at the Standing Committee on Health in Ottawa, life seems to go on in Vancouver, where another dispensary has been issued a business licence.
Westcoast Medicann, located at 3178 Cambie Street, has been issued a licence after successfully meeting all city zoning requirements and obtaining a development permit.
The dispensary, which according to its website, requires that all members are licensed to consume cannabis by Health Canada before purchasing cannabis, is a retail medical marijuana-related storefront under the City's medical marijuana-related use (MMRU) bylaws.
It is the 12th dispensary in the city to receive a business licence since the implementation of the MMRU bylaws in 2015.
The shop has been operating since 2014.
